I have 8" rear ITP beadlocks with 18x10x8 holeshot mxr. My question is: if i purchase 9" beadlocks and run a 18x10x9 holeshot mxr will the bike be geared higher or will the wheel speed change?

EvilJester400EX
06-21-2005, 08:53 PM
The speed will remain the same. Changing the rim size will only make the ride different (bumpy or smooth).

I run 18x10x9 maxxis razrs, the grip is great and the sidewalls have less flex in the coners than 9in holeshots. You get a marginally less harsh ride with 8in rims, but 9's are less likely to fold fron a hard landing as well, get either beadlocks or T9 baja rims they last and allow you to run less air, negating the easier ride of the 8's.:chinese:
